DDT TOO REQUEST OF GS 1354-64
A new outburst is currently taking place in the black hole X-ray binary system known as GS 1354-64. The level of its flux has reached 100 milli-Crab, and it is continuing to rise. Based on the hard X-ray data with NuSTAR, the source is supposed to be a black hole candidate that is spinning at a high rate; however, XRISM has never been observed such a kind of binaries. In order to resolve the iron line region of GS 1354-64, we request a 100 kilo-seconds XRISM observation using Resolve. This could be helpful in isolating any narrow characteristics that were not able to be resolved by the CCD-resolution data that was collected in the past, and it could also yield more accurate measurements of the black hole spin.
